Struct git_attributes::PatternList
source · pub struct PatternList<T: Pattern> {
pub patterns: Vec<PatternMapping<T::Value>>,
pub source: Option<PathBuf>,
pub base: Option<BString>,
}
Expand description
A list of patterns which optionally know where they were loaded from and what their base is.
Knowing their base which is relative to a source directory, it will ignore all path to match against that don’t also start with said base.
Fields§
§patterns: Vec<PatternMapping<T::Value>>
Patterns and their associated data in the order they were loaded in or specified,
the line number in its source file or its sequence number ((pattern, value, line_number)
).
During matching, this order is reversed.
source: Option<PathBuf>
The path from which the patterns were read, or None
if the patterns
don’t originate in a file on disk.
base: Option<BString>
The parent directory of source, or None
if the patterns are global to match against the repository root.
It’s processed to contain slashes only and to end with a trailing slash, and is relative to the repository root.
